			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>[WARNING! SPOILERS ABOUND! READ AT YOUR OWN RISK!]</strong></p>
<p>So  I recently was able to watch the six-episode first season of <em>The  Walking Dead</em>, the AMC show about zombies based on the graphic novels of  the same name. In general, I enjoyed them, a lot. I really love how the  zombie genre has turned into stories of human character, rather than  just horror stories of the undead prowling around trying to eat  everyone. And six episodes is a good way to get in, establish  characters, setting, and loose plotline, while not dragging on too long.  Six episodes should be the default for first seasons, I think. You show  what’s up, then you show that you’re good enough to last more than one  season.</p>
<p>I  haven’t read the graphic novels, but I certainly plan on doing so now,  because there were aspects of the TV show that bugged me, and I want to  see if they bug me in the books as well. Shane’s character arc went from  genuinely thoughtful to “rapey” in two second flat. Basically, the last  episode bugged me the most because, as I’ve heard, it deviated  significantly from the comic books, and it turned a show about the  struggles of a band of survivors into an action sequence, where the CDC  explodes. Because decontamination = explosions.</p>
<p>The  last two episodes just progressed too quickly, and dropped character  investigation for more action, more surprises. And it turned Shane into a  genuine character into a drunk and a potential rapist. While I  understand that Shane has serious issues with being pushed aside as  Lori’s husband returns from death, this flip was just too quick. Yes,  six episodes is quick, but it also demonstrated the attitude of “get  everything in because we might not have a second season,” which is just  unfair to the audience. From the first episode alone, it’s obvious that  AMC would pick up a second season. They got huge ratings from the show.  Instead, we got drunk Shane and the CDC exploding.</p>
<p>Here’s  another thing that really bugged me about the last episode. So Bruce  Jenner locks up the place &#8212; okay, before that, people are enjoying  themselves and Dr Jenner sits back, looking like he knows something, and  also we see the ticking clock in the background … here’s my thing: why  is Dr Jenner such a dick? Why wouldn’t he just say, “Listen, I’m running  out of fuel for the generator” and give people enough time to maybe  syphon some from their cars so they can keep the place running for a  little while longer? Also, why doesn’t the goddamn COMPUTER say,  “WARNING, GENERATOR FUEL LOW” at regular intervals?! What kind of  building is this? An advanced computer capable of following detailed  voice commands, but it won’t tell you that the GENERATOR IS RUNNING OUT  OF FUEL?! Why just a digital countdown clock?! That’s not very advanced  at all! I had a digital clock once &#8212; back in 1996! Come on, CDC! Get it  together!</p>
<p>Anyway,  so the lockdown happens, and Bruce is being a real dick (probably  because now that zombies are everywhere, he can’t get a good run in),  and then Rick convinces him to open the lockdown doors, but some people  want to stay, because they think it’s better to die than to try to fend  off zombies. These people are losers, but whatever. So it’s two people,  Jacqui (whose name I got from Wikipedia, because who says it in the  series?) and Andrea. Jacqui says she wants to stay and her husband? is  pissed but she says it’s okay and so okay, we’ll leave her because we  don’t have time for this shit. Then Andrea says she wants to stay, and  SUDDENLY WE HAVE TIME FOR A PEP TALK. And moreover, Dale convinces  Andrea to come along, but DOESN’T TRY TO CONVINCE JACQUI?! What is this  bullshit?! Why did everyone just think, “Well, Jacqui doesn’t want to  come, and she really didn’t do anything in this series anyway, so let’s  just let her go.”</p>
<p>It  really doesn’t help that she’s a black woman, either. Save the white  girl, but let the black woman die. It would be great if there were time  to navigate this territory, but instead we are given five minutes to Get  the Fuck Out. So for the last episode, they chose action over character  progression. It’s kind of lame, in my opinion.</p>
<p>Seriously,  the last episode is so hastily put together it drives me nuts. They use  a grenade to break the window to escape. A grenade breaks ONE window,  with no surrounding damage. IT’S A GRENADE! That whole scene is so  disappointing.</p>
<p>Argh,  the scene with Dale and Andrea at the end drives me nuts. Who does  that? It’s like they literally forgot about Jacqui. And then she and  Bruce join hands before the CDC explodes, as though they were best  friends all along. Don’t forget, Jacqui, and Dr Jenner PRETTY MUCH TRIED  TO KILL YOU.</p>
<p>Anyway.  Now that a second season has been commissioned, and all the writers  leaving, I hope whomever they get to replace them will have better  plotting skills than this. The first five episodes were excellent, up to  the point where the CDC was introduced. Then it went to Shitsville. No  more action sequences like that. Storytelling. That’s what makes a  zombie show great.</p>
<p>Now it’s time to buy the graphic novels and see how things really went down.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Dear Food Items with &#8220;Hint of Salt&#8221; Emblazoned On Their Packaging,</p>
<p>It appears we have come to an impasse. You, dear food item, have had a transcendental realization: that you may have too much salt in or on you. I have come to a similar realization: that I, too, may have too much salt in or on me. Thus, we both enter introspective negotiations, you, with your earnest decision to reduce your sodium, and me, with my acknowledgment of, well, gout, I suppose. And kidney stones? Is that how that works?</p>
<p>Either way, here we currently sit, Food Item, confused and frightened, desperately wanting to hold each other but at the same time worried, anxious, maybe a little depressed. Maybe a little &#8230; let down. People, people add salt to everything, right? They add salt to already salty things. They would sprinkle salt on a salt lick for chrissakes if it was being licked by horses, with their disgusting germy horse tongues. But here you are, removed of all but a simple touch of salt. And here I am, ready to head down a terrible path, a path wherein &#8220;pass the salt&#8221; becomes a taboo as dire as Japanese pubic hair.</p>
<p>What do we do? Do I eat you? I am afraid, but curious. Do things taste the same with less salt? How would we know? We are a gluttonous country; when we eat Chinese food, it is not truly the food that Chinese people eat, and they know it, and we know it, and they put MSG in it because they know we are addicted to MSG. There are some things that taste good without salt, to me at least: corn on the cob. Potatoes. Ice cream. However, if you put salt on them &#8212; copious, copious amounts of salt, maybe some butter, sour cream, a dollop of lard &#8212; they leave the mortal plane of Food and enter the astral plane of Delicious. Not the ice cream though. Let&#8217;s leave ice cream out of this. I&#8217;m sorry I even brought it up.</p>
<p>The point being, I just ate a sleeve of you, specifically Ritz crackers with a &#8220;hint of salt,&#8221; and let me say &#8212; no. You don&#8217;t taste like Ritz. You taste like Shitz. YES I WENT THERE. I went there and I built a hammock, and now I&#8217;m resting and wearing sunglasses there. But really. Really? I&#8217;ve had the Lays potato chips with a hint of salt, and you know what? They taste great! They taste BETTER than the original Lays. I don&#8217;t feel like my taste buds have been scraped off when I eat the hint of salt Lays. But these Ritz! Why? I have three more sleeves to eat! And I will eat them, oh yes, but why? Why do you taste so wrong?</p>
<p>Also afterwards I went to lunch at the Greek deli and ate really salty french fries. Will I ever learn?</p>
<p>Sincerely,<br />
Josh</p>
